CANADIAN WOOL

INCREASED PRODUCTION. Tlio sheep raising industry is an expanding branch of Canadian agriculture. This is particularly noticeable in the four Western provinces, according to W. H. J. Tisdale, assistant general manager of the Canadian Co-operative Wool Growers. “Wo expect 2,750,0001 b. of Western wool this .season,” says Mr Tisdale. "Of this wool approximately 1,750,0001 b will be range wool, with the balance Western domestic. The total will run about 400,0001 b. above the 1925 figure.”
